  • Publication number: 20160057019
    Abstract: The present invention is generally directed at systems and methods for managing one or more data centers. Systems in accordance with some embodiments of the invention may include a software as a service (SaaS) application including a user interface for designing or modifying a topology, a VAR application in selective communication with the SaaS application and with one or more data stores, configured to determine how to create or modify the topology by configuring the one or more data centers. Methods in accordance with some embodiments of the invention may include receiving a topology design or edit, communicating with one or more data centers, determining how to satisfy the topology design or edit based on the topology design or edit and communications with the one or more data centers; and satisfying the topology design or edit by creating the designed topology or editing the pre-existing topology.

  • Publication number: 20120144364
    Abstract: A technique for using an application user interface that executes on a system is described. During operation of the system, a user specifies a design topology and configuration of an application that executes in a networked-computing environment through the application user interface. Then, the system provisions the application by bringing up associated hardware and/or software based on the design specified through the application user interface. Moreover, the application user interface monitors the application status during execution of the application so that application managers, application developers and application operators have access to the same information at different levels of an organizational hierarchy in the networked-computing environment.
